Before diving into the services offered by Micro Center, let’s briefly explore what 3D printing is. 3D printing, also known as additive manufacturing, involves creating three-dimensional objects from a digital file. This technology has revolutionized various industries, including healthcare, automotive, and consumer products, by allowing for rapid prototyping and customization.

Using the 3D printing services at Micro Center is straightforward. Here’s a step-by-step guide:
You can design your object using CAD software or download pre-existing models from sites like Thingiverse. Ensure your file is compatible with the printers used at Micro Center.
Locate your nearest Micro Center and bring your design file on a USB drive or access it through cloud storage.
Once at Micro Center, consult with the staff at the 3D printing station. They will review your design and help you choose the right material and settings for your print.
After finalizing the details, your design will be queued for printing. Depending on the complexity and size, printing times may vary.
Once the print is complete, you can review your object with the staff to ensure it meets your expectations before taking it home.
